Output 660e57164851de624932707d76169271ee29e274b672f16875b3390b53bc816e:9

value
8524584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130675141e6d02ea5495ee6cc3d923038d9d030b OP_EQUAL
address
33RcVrPFUCc6bbgQ7zq5bFc51zYx2NHfrT
transaction
660e57164851de624932707d76169271ee29e274b672f16875b3390b53bc816e
spent
true